Italian cruise with an italian cruise sh by TomL6

Sail date: / Traveled as: Large Group
Ship: MSC Musica / Destination: Europe - Eastern Mediterranean

At some of the ports take the tours. But if you are an European traveler and feel that you can make it on your own with the public transport system then do. In athens take the Public Bus to all the places you want to go and the trains too. The bus cost you .50 euro cents. While in Santorini take a cab to the end of the island to view the town. It cost me 40 Euros for the four of us to ride in the cab. The driver waited for us and took us back to the drop off point for the cruise. Also when you have to use the tenders to get off the ship go down to the door and wait. We had a very high number in Santorini and was waiting and was able to leave the ship as soon as we got down to the tender area. The food service was good and were at times saying we need to stop eating. Buy the pre paid drinks for the ship they are a good value if you drink a lot of bottle water. The price for a coke or the bottle water is the same when you prepay but you get a liter of water and only a can of soda.

A DISSAPOINTMENT by KurtB26127877

Sail date: / Traveled as: Couple
Ship: Costa Concordia (RETIRED) 548 / Destination: Europe - Eastern Mediterranean

INITIAL IMPRESSION: My wife and I boarded the Costa Concordia for our honeymoon in December and embarked on a 10 day cruise of the Eastern Mediterranean. As soon as we boarded we felt unwelcome. We contacted the Costa customer service before we boarded and were told that the cruise staff would provide us with items such as bathrobes, slippers and champagne for our honeymoon. When we boarded I spoke to customer service about it and they flatly denied that they do this for couples. Right off the bat, Costa was frustrating. After this we tried to enjoy our cruise on board the Concordia but found this to be difficult. STAFF ON BOARD: The staff on board the Concordia is not helpful in the least. I am a very easy going person but found myself getting extremely frustrated with the staff. When asking the customer service desk for information about ports, they had no idea what they were talking about. They would give me a map and expect me to figure it out on my own. Even when I asked specific questions about transportation off the ship, they would guess at the answer and shrug their shoulders. The waiters were also very slow with the exception of our waiter at dinner. Most bar staff and wait staff never smiled at us or even bothered to seat us. We even observed many of bar and wait staff text messaging people on their cell phones constantly. Our cabin steward was the best staff member on the ship. He was the only one who went out of his way to help us. When smoke was billowing in our room from the adjoining cabin, customer service told us we would have to deal with it. We asked our cabin boy to tape the door shut which solved the problem. SMOKING ON BOARD: Europeans smoke everywhere. There were some sections of the ship which were deemed non-smoking, but the people on board rarely observed these restrictions. The bars were often so choked with cigarette smoke that we couldn't stand being there. The casino was especially bad. If you are sensitive to smoke, do not choose this ship. FOOD AND ITINERARY: These were the two good things about the ship. The seated dinner was very good. We ate there almost every night and were rarely disappointed. The buffet breakfast and lunch were another matter. There was rarely a variety at the buffet and it really wasn't very good. The itinerary for our trip was incredible. If you choose to this trip, do it for the sole purpose of seeing some of the most incredible places on earth. The Pyramids of Giza, The Acropolis in Athens, Old Rhodes (which is absolutely incredible), Rome, and the site of the ancient Olympics to name a few. LASTING IMPRESSION: What I came away from this trip with was a greater understanding of many world cultures and some of the best pictures I will ever take. On the other hand, my wife and I will never take another Costa cruise, nor will we ever recommend the company to anyone. The staff was awful, many of whom complained about Costa to passengers, including us. In fact, Costa no longer allows passengers to leave tips in the envelopes like on most other ships. They now take 20% directly from the price you paid for the cruise and tip according to the surveys you fill out at the end of the cruise. If a staff member gets low ratings, Costa keeps the excess amount (at least this is what we were told by a number of staff members). Also, being an American on a European cruise is nothing but a headache. The Italians especially have no respect for lines of people. The will push, shove, cut, and basically do anything to get what they want with no respect for other people. Trust me when I say that you will be frustrated by the people on this ship. DO NOT SAIL WITH COSTA FOR THE SAILING EXPERIENCE. Sail with Costa only for the itinerary.

The worst cruise I've ever been on! by KarenK15

Sail date: / Traveled as: Family (older children)
Ship: Costa Mediterranea / Destination: Europe - Eastern Mediterranean

First let me say that this ship went out of Venice to Greece and Croatia. for half of the year it goes out from Fort Lauderdale and the staff and food changes. This is my 7th cruise and was horrified at many things. There was blatant discrimination against Americans the entire time we were on the ship. This is mainly an Italian ship with Italian staff and crew. We were treated poorly, they group everyone by nationality on the tender boats, excursions, etc. Guess who was always last? We were. We waited for hours to leave the ship for an excursion because the English went last and they let the entire ship off before us. We were not the only Americans that felt this way. We complained to the front desk numerous times and finally ended up getting a bottle of champagne for the way were treated. There are absolutely no rules on this ship. Hottubs were to be for no one under 18 and at all times there were 12-15 kids in each hottub. We complained non-stop and they said they had no one to enforce the rule. Kids from the age of 1 to 15 were in all the bars, clogging the dance floors, at all the shows, in the casino and running rampant in the hallways. We would go into the theater for the horrible shows and we would trip over the line of strollers that lined the rows. The worst food I have ever had in my life. The airline food we had going over and back was like a 5 star meal compared to this. Shrimp the texture of mashed potatoes, rotten fish, beef the consistency of shoe leather and virtually everything on their menu was pre-frozen. Yuck! The absolutely only redeeming factor was the itinerary and even that needed some work.
